How to use Neon Alley Surge

Overview

The "Neon Alley Surge" palette delivers an electrifying punch of futuristic energy, contrasting deep purples with intensely bright neons. It features a profound dark purple (#2A0A3D), a rich electric violet (#6F00FF), brilliant cyan (#00FFFF), intense magenta (#FF00FF), and a luminous yellow (#FCF921). This palette is perfectly crafted for designers and developers aiming to evoke a high-energy, urban night aesthetic with a distinct cyberpunk edge. The dark anchor allows the vibrant hues to truly pop, making it ideal for dynamic UI elements, eye-catching branding, and digital art that needs to convey both depth and dazzling light.

Suggested color roles

primary

#2A0A3D (Profound Dark Purple) - Serves as the deep, grounding background color, providing contrast for the bright neons.

secondary

#6F00FF (Electric Violet) - Excellent for secondary sections, large interactive areas, or subtle glowing accents.

accent

#FCF921 (Luminous Yellow) - Use sparingly for critical alerts, small icons, or to draw immediate attention to key features.

background

#2A0A3D (Profound Dark Purple) - The main backdrop, allowing the lighter, more vibrant colors to surge forward.

text

#00FFFF (Brilliant Cyan) or white - For headings and important text against dark backgrounds; a near-white for body copy for optimal readability.

Accessibility notes

  • Ensure text in #00FFFF, #FF00FF, or #FCF921 has sufficient contrast against the dark background colors like #2A0A3D and #6F00FF.
  • Avoid using #6F00FF for small text on #2A0A3D as contrast may be insufficient.
  • Always test color combinations for WCAG AA compliance, especially for text and interactive elements.
  • Be mindful of the intensity of the bright colors and consider a less vibrant alternative for extended reading if necessary.
